TurnKey Linux 14.0 Is a Massive Release Based on Debian GNU/Linux 8.0 Jessie

Prominent features of TurnKey Linux 14.0 include replacement of the PHPMyAdmin and PHPPgAdmin software with Adminer as the default database management tool, hardened default SSL (Secure Sockets Layer) and TLS (Transport Layer Security) settings, and the addition of Monit, a minimalist monitoring system that alerts users when CPU, RAM, and/or HDD limits are hit, via email.
